Description

This exceptional semi-detached freehold house combines beautifully preserved period character with a meticulous, high-specification architectural design. Spanning 1,779 square feet over two main levels, the home has been completely re-wired and comprehensively modernised throughout. The ground floor layout flows from a grand entrance hallway featuring a custom stained-glass front door, Havwoods timber flooring, and sophisticated Corinthia-inspired chandeliers. To the front is a striking bay-fronted winter reception room, meticulously styled with a feature fireplace and bespoke fitted bookshelves with integrated cabinet lighting.

The heart of the home is a state-of-the-art open-plan kitchen and dining area completed with sleek modern cabinetry, a substantial central island, dual wine fridges, a Quooker instant boiling water tap, and a premium utility corridor. The entire area spanning the kitchen, dining space, and utility corridor benefits from underfloor heating, leading into a separate summer reception room where an entire wall of bi-folding doors slides completely open to reveal the garden. The ground floor is completed by a practical under-stairs utility zone housing the laundry appliances and distribution boards.

The first floor comprises four well-proportioned bedrooms and a luxury central bathroom installation featuring a deep freestanding Betty bath and fully tanked wet-room elements. The primary bedroom is a generous bay-fronted haven with handmade fitted wardrobes and integrated lighting, while the main guest room enjoys its own bespoke en-suite shower room and handmade storage. Accessible from the landing is a massive, fully boarded loft space with power and light, housing a new boiler under warranty. Externally, the property benefits from an expansive, manicured rear lawn with dual powered sheds, secure new fencing, and a private driveway providing off-street parking to the front.

Braxted Park is an idyllic residential address situated within easy reach of Streatham Common, Streatham, and Norbury mainline stations, providing effortless commuting direct to the City and West End. The location is highly coveted by families, benefiting from a dedicated bus service to premium independent schools in nearby Dulwich and Croydon. Residents have the beautiful Rookery Gardens and the open expanses of Streatham Common on their doorstep, offering year-round events, festivals, and fairs. A diverse selection of independent cafés, boutique shops, large supermarkets, and the popular gastro-pub "The Bull" are all within a short walk.

Winkworth was established in 1835 and, in 1981, became the UK's first franchised estate agency operation. Now, with a network of over 80 offices and, as an active supporter of industry regulation, Winkworth is a familiar and trusted feature of the estate agency landscape. Along with an extensive London presence, Winkworth has offices spanning the UK and an increasing international presence.
